What Could You Do With a Bogus Root Name Server?

Posted by Soulskill on Sun Jun 01, 2008 12:11 PM
from the root-root-root-for-the-home-team dept.
Barlaam notes a post from the Renesys Blog which follows up on news they discussed a couple weeks ago about the 'identity theft' of a root name server. To emphasize the issue of safeguarding such a system, they've now posted an explanation of exactly how the situation could be exploited. "It shouldn't be too hard to see that you could end up answering every DNS query from an organization that came to you for an updated list of root name servers. Every one. And you might end up doing this for a very long time, especially if your answers were largely correct. An attack like this would have no resemblance to the YouTube hijack, where the entire planet gets a blank page and it's immediately apparent that something isn't right. Obvious events like this will continue to occur, and we'll continue to resolve them relatively quickly. But as this incident demonstrates, DNS hijacks are far less obvious and potentially far more harmful."

aos101 writes "The Renesys blog has an interesting story about networks advertising the old address space of the L root name server after ICANN changed the IP address last November. These networks were also running root name servers on the old IP address of the L root name server up until last week, so any DNS servers still using the old IP address might have been getting their answers from these bogus name servers. A very cursory examination by Renesys of one of these bogus servers found that it appeared to be providing correct responses, which might be why no one noticed the problem. As Renesys points out, the volume of traffic to a root server is staggering, so the people running these bogus root servers must have had a reason. What did they get out of it?"

  • Simple recipe (Score:5, Insightful)

    by canuck57 (662392) on Sunday June 01 2008, @12:22PM (#23618381)

    If you have lost DNS, game is over, you lose. A recipe if your system hits a compromised root server.

    • You open up email to read todays email. You PC looks up pop3.yourisp.com.
    • DNS returns the IP of evil PC to your PC which will connect to it.
    • Next, evil PC will emulate your login, IP address and record the password. Could even be a /. password.
    • Evil pc now has the info needed to read/retrieve your email.

    Better yet, people often use similar IDs and passwords into other systems. Evil hackers can often use the email to figure out which banks, credit, stock brokers and on line e-tailers you use. Maybe change the home address of your Amazon account and order stuff, if the e-tailor isn't right on top of it.

    Root servers need to be secure, end of story.

    I should note the above method would also work with SSL, be creative, it only has to be a legitimate cert with a root chain.

    • Re:Simple recipe (Score:5, Informative)

      by Vellmont (569020) on Sunday June 01 2008, @01:07PM (#23618723)

      If you have lost DNS, game is over, you lose. A recipe if your system hits a compromised root server.

      Unless you happen to have SSL enabled pop or imap.

      A (revised) recipe for an SSL enabled mail host:
              * You open up email to read todays email. You PC looks up pop3.yourisp.com.
              * DNS returns the IP of evil PC to your PC which will connect to it.
              * Evil PC returns a forged SSL certfificate claiming to be pop3.yourisp.com
              * Your email client brings up an error message saying there's something wrong with this certificate (self signed, etc)
              * You hopefully get suspicious, (this never having happened before), and don't click through.
              * Attack fails.

      If you don't get suspicious, and just click OK, you're right. But the situation isn't quite as dire as you make it out to be. I'd never connect to a non-secure host for something like email.

        • Re: (Score:3, Informative)

          No, because without a password, most password authenticated key exchange algorithm have the same security properties as Diffie-Hellman. In other words, even if you knew the password, you couldn't snoop the connection passively. The only way to thwart it is by an active attack, but for that you need the password, otherwise the two parties' keys won't match.

  • by karl.auerbach (157250) on Sunday June 01 2008, @12:38PM (#23618473) Homepage
    Back in Febrary 2006 I wrote a note "What Could You Do With Your Own Root Server" at
    http://www.cavebear.com/cbblog-archives/000232.html

    My conclusions were that one could make money and cause trouble.

    One of the more interesting aspects was (and still is) that one could operate root servers and, using the Google model, pay ISPs and users to send their queries to your roots so that you could generate data mining revenues.

    That quality of data that is minded form root traffic would not be as good as that as from a top level domain server - and who has some large top level domains and also has root servers? Verisign.

    And ICANN's contract with Verisign explicitly permits data mining of query traffic.
